JUNIOR SOFTWARE QUALITY TESTING ENGINEER
Edge Autonomy Riga is an international company with its main office in the USA, and we are part of the Redwire group. We specialize in the development, manufacturing, and integration of autonomous un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) and electro-optical surveillance systems. Our products are widely used in defense, security, civil, and industrial sectors around the world. The company culture is built on innovation, sustainability, mutual respect, and international collaboration.
We are looking for a Junior Software Quality Testing Engineer to ensure software excellence by conducting systematic manual testing across all development stages, identifying and documenting issues, and working closely with the development team to resolve them effectively.
Responsibilities
- Ensure manual testing to make sure software meets requirements.
- Reviewing documentation and release notes to help update test scenarios.
- Running manual test cases and performing both scripted and exploratory tests.
- Logging and reporting bugs to the development team.
- Supporting troubleshooting and other quality-related tasks as needed.
- College degree in IT or a related field, or a manual testing certification (e.g., ISTQB® Certified Tester Foundation Level or equivalent).
- Preferred experience with bug-tracking or testing tools (e.g., JIRA, TestRail, Zephyr).
- Basic understanding of software testing methodologies, test cycles, and documentation.
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y.
- Willingness to learn, with good anal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Ability to work both independently and as part of a team, with good communication skills.
- Good Latvian and English language skills spoken and written.
- Modern production facility with cutting-edge equipment and a dynamic work environment.
- Salary 1800-2250 EUR gross per month depending on experience.
- Health and children accident insurance, after probation time.
- Accident insurance from first day.
- Annual bonus program based on performance.
- Yearly salary review.
- Financial support in special life situations.
- Free parking and company shuttle bus Jelgava–Rīga–Jelgava.
